WHO WE ARE:
Tech Met, Inc. an employee-owned company, is a leader in custom and standard chemical milling. Providing services to the Aerospace, Medical, Military and Commercial markets with precision chemical milling on fabricated components since 1988, we specialize in complex and precise chemical milling for build to print and custom projects on a wide variety of materials.

RESPONSIBILITIES/DUTIES:
- Assist the Quality Manager and Process Quality Engineer (PQE) in performing and documenting solution analysis.
- Perform incoming, in-process and final inspections of parts as required.
- Perform standard wet process laboratory analysis such as chemical bath titrations.
- Maintain proper quality logs and/or quality records as required by customer and government agencies.
- 50% of job will require parts measurement.
- Perform and document quality compliance audits as necessary.
- Perform and document calibration of quality critical equipment and instrumentation.
- Assist in the training of personnel in quality requirements and related procedures.
- Complete and/or verify part quality documentation (certifications, job control documents, etc.)
- FAA repair station safety sensitive inspection. FAA mandated drug and alcohol testing applies to this position.
